A study was conducted using two groups of 10 plants of the same species. During the study, the plants were placed in identical environmental conditions. The plants in one group were given a growth solution every 3 days. The heights of the plants in both groups were recorded at the beginning of the study and at the end of a 3-week period. The data showed that the plants given the growth solution grew faster than those not given the solution. When other researchers conduct this study to test the accuracy of the results, they should
give growth solution to both groups
make sure the conditions are identical to those in the first study
give an increased amount of light to both groups of plants
double the amount of growth solution given to the first group

To test the effect of hormones on plant growth, six potted plant seedlings of the same species were measured and then sprayed with auxin (a growth hormone). After four weeks of growth under ideal conditions, the plants were measured again. To set up a proper control for this experiment, the investigator should
spray the same plants with different amounts of auxin
spray auxin on six plant seedlings of the same species and grow them in the dark for four weeks
wash the auxin off three of the plants after two weeks
grow another six plant seedlings of the same species under the same conditions, spraying them with distilled water only
